Ethereum Magician's dialogue on EIP-8304 introduces a draft design for trustless logging and transaction indexing, which goals to make it simpler to validate historic searches and not using a centralized indexer.
TL;DR
- EIP-8304 proposes a less complicated trustless logging and transaction indexing design.
- The purpose is to permit apps and light-weight purchasers to extra effectively look at historic logs and transactions.
- This proposal might cut back reliance on centralized off-chain indexers.
- That is nonetheless an early draft and no implementation schedule has been confirmed.
An easier indexing proposal for Ethereum
The brand new Ethereum Magician dialogue on EIP-8304 focuses on a technical however essential a part of the developer stack: how purposes and light-weight purchasers can validate logs and transactions with out relying fully on a centralized index supplier. Though this proposal is tied to the broader Trustless Log Index challenge, its authors body it as a less complicated design than EIP-7745.
Indexing isn’t the flashiest a part of Ethereum, however it is among the most essential. Wallets, explorers, analytics platforms, DeFi dashboards, bridges, and light-weight purchasers all want a dependable option to reply questions on previous transactions and occasions. Presently, most of the solutions are offered by off-chain indexers and infrastructure corporations.
Why trustless logs are essential
Though Ethereum is already trustless in its consensus layer, user-facing purposes typically depend on third-party infrastructure to make historic knowledge out there. In case your app must know if a sure occasion has occurred, if a contract has emitted a log, or if a transaction belongs to a sure historical past, it might depend on exterior indexers. That dependency can create availability, censorship, and verification dangers.
EIP-8304 proposes storing the basis hash of the index desk within the system contract to allow environment friendly trustless proofing of logs and transaction lookups. In layman's phrases, the concept is to make it simpler to show that historic logs or transactions belong to Ethereum's canonical knowledge, with out requiring a centralized service to easily be trusted.
Developer instruments, not retail performance
This isn’t a proposal that can change gasoline costs in a single day or create a brand new token narrative. Its worth is positioned deeper within the stack. If profitable, it might enhance gentle shopper design, distributed purposes, occasion validation, and infrastructure reliability. So even when the software turns into extra sturdy, it is going to be an improve that’s not instantly noticeable to customers.
It's too early to suggest. Discussion board posts describe the draft, present key factors, and show the standing as “Draft.” There is no such thing as a implementation schedule or remaining adoption path, and there’s no assure that Ethereum's core builders will undertake the design.
A part of Ethereum's long-term infrastructure work
Ethereum's roadmap is commonly mentioned by means of massive themes corresponding to scaling, account abstraction, privateness, and validator adjustments. However the long-term usefulness of the community additionally relies on small infrastructure enhancements that permit builders to construct decentralized purposes. Trustless indexing matches into that class.
For cryptocurrency builders, EIP-8304 is value watching as a result of it addresses a silent dependency in Web3: the truth that it’s as decentralized as the info infrastructure that many purposes use. If Ethereum can simply confirm historic occasions and transaction lookups natively, it might probably cut back its reliance on trusted intermediaries in elements of the stack that not often obtain public consideration.
This text was written by Newsdesk and edited by Samuel Ray.

